Many airlines in Europe and the United States of America have hoped that the Biden government will ease their entry requirements quickly. Nothing seems to come of this, at least in the short term.
In any case, it is certain that in the future the full vaccination against Covid-19 will be a basic requirement for entry. The Travel Ban for EU citizens and other states in Europe, which was enacted under Donald Trump, has not yet been lifted. Nothing about that will change in the short term.
The US government does not intend to relax before the end of November 2021. As a possible date, there is a vague prospect that there could be gradual openings after Thanksgiving. This has been heavily criticized by airlines on both sides of the Atlantic. Immediate opening is requested for fully vaccinated people.
